我使用Bootstrap datepicker从用户那里获取日期。我将该值存储在数据库中。 但是当我用html渲染这个日期时,它显示了日期的意外值!
我给出结果的屏幕截图。
任何人都可以帮我解决这个问题吗?
答案 0 :(得分:1)
您是如何将日期存储在数据库中的?
确保您使用的是DATETIME而非VARCHAR
另外,您是如何从数据库中获取日期的?
我会用:
$query = "SELECT DATE_FORMAT(ColumnName, '%Y-%m-%d %H:%i:%s') AS Date FROM Table";
$result = mysqli_query($cxn,$query) or die(mysqli_error());
$date = $result->fetch_object()->Date;